언어/기타
2006.01.08 06:58

밑에 교역시스템글... 여러가지 추가

조회 수 391 추천 수 1 댓글 0
?

단축키

Prev이전 문서

Next다음 문서

크게 작게 위로 아래로 댓글로 가기 인쇄 수정 삭제
?

단축키

Prev이전 문서

Next다음 문서

크게 작게 위로 아래로 댓글로 가기 인쇄 수정 삭제
---------------예)후추------------------------------------
후추:향신료로 인도에서 많이 재배됀다.

     -구입시(인도)-

변수의조작:[1:향신료시세]대입,난수80~120
변수의조작:[2:후추가격]대입,300 (300원의경우)
변수의조작:[2:후추가격]곱셈,[변수1]
변수의조작:[2:후추가격]나눗셈,100
문장의표시: 현제 후추의 시세는 V[1]이여서,
                 현제 후추가격은 V[2]입니다. 사시겠습니까?
선택지의표시:예,아니오
예의경우>
문장의표시:몇개를사시겠습니까?
수치입력의처리:3자리 [3:후추팔고사는갯수]에유효
문장의표시:정말로 V[3]만큼 사시겠습니까?
선택지의표시:예,아니오
예의경우>
변수의조작[2:후추가격]곱셈,[변수3]
문장의표시:후추의 총가격은 V[2]입니다. 사시겠습니까?
선택지의표시:예,아니오
예의경우>
변수의조작:[4:현제 주인공이 가진돈]대입,가진돈
조건분기:[2]가 [4]이하
가진돈의증감:변수[2]만큼 감산
변수의조작:[5:후추갯수]가산,[변수3]
변수의조작:[6:적재량]가산,[변수3]
그외의경우:
문장의표시:돈이 부족합니다.
아니오의경우>
문장의표시:알겠습니다
아니오의경우>
문장의표시:알겠습니다.
아니오의경우>
문장의표시:알겠습니다.

     -파는경우(유럽)-

변수의조작:[1:향신료시세]대입,난수80~120
변수의조작:[2:후추가격]대입,6000 (6000원의경우)
변수의조작:[2:후추가격]곱셈,[변수1]
변수의조작:[2:후추가격]나눗셈,100
문장의표시: 현제 후추의 시세는 V[1]이여서,
                 현제 후추가격은 V[2]입니다. 파시겠습니까?
선택지의표시:예,아니오
예의경우>
문장의표시:몇개를파시겠습니까?
수치입력의처리:3자리 [3:후추팔고사는갯수]에유효
조건분기:[3]이 [5]이하
문장의표시:정말로 V[3]만큼 파시겠습니까?
선택지의표시:예,아니오
예의경우>
변수의조작[2:후추가격]곱셈,[변수3]
문장의표시:후추의 총가격은 V[2]입니다. 파시겠습니까?
선택지의표시:예,아니오
예의경우>
가진돈의증감:변수[2]만큼 가산
변수의조작:[5:후추갯수]감산,[변수3]
변수의조작:[6:적재량]감산,[변수3]
아니오의경우>
문장의표시:알겠습니다
아니오의경우>
문장의표시:알겠습니다.
그외의경우:
문장의표시:후추의 갯수가 부족합니다.
아니오의경우>
문장의표시:알겠습니다.
----------------------------------------------------------------------------------------
이런식으로하면 대충완료됩니다.

하지만 이럴시에는,팔때 999999원 이상으로는 못팔게돼죠.
그러므로 팔때는 이렇게 추가해주시면 더욱좋습니다.(사는경우는 제게임에선 100만이상 사는경우가 없기에,안쓰겠습니다.)
------------------------------------------------------------------------------------------
     -파는경우(유럽,100만이상거래)-(단, 100%시세가 1000,2000원,13000원 같이 100원대의자리가 업서야합니다.)

변수의조작:[1:향신료시세]대입,난수80~120
변수의조작:[2:후추가격]대입,6000 (6000원의경우)
변수의조작:[2:후추가격]곱셈,[변수1]
변수의조작:[2:후추가격]나눗셈,100
문장의표시: 현제 후추의 시세는 V[1]이여서,
                 현제 후추가격은 V[2]입니다. 파시겠습니까?
선택지의표시:예,아니오
예의경우>
문장의표시:몇개를파시겠습니까?
수치입력의처리:3자리 [3:후추팔고사는갯수]에유효
조건분기:[3]이 [5]이하
문장의표시:정말로 V[3]만큼 파시겠습니까?
선택지의표시:예,아니오
예의경우>
변수의조작[2:후추가격]나눗셈,10
변수의조작[2:후추가격]곱셈,[변수3]
변수의조작[7:100만이상빼기]대입,[변수2]
변수의조작[7:100만이상빼기]나눗셈,100000
변수의조작[8:100만이하구하기]대입,100000
변수의조작[8:100만이하구하기]곱셈,[변수7]
변수의조작[2:후추가격]감산,[변수8]
변수의조작[2:후추가격]곱셈,10
문장의표시:후추의 총가격은 V[7]00(백 이라써도됩니다.)만원+V[2]원입니다. 파시겠습니까?
선택지의표시:예,아니오
예의경우>
가진돈의증감:변수[2]만큼 가산
아이템의증감:백만원 변수[7]만큼 가산
변수의조작:[5:후추갯수]감산,[변수3]
변수의조작:[6:적재량]감산,[변수3]
아니오의경우>
문장의표시:알겠습니다
아니오의경우>
문장의표시:알겠습니다.
그외의경우:
문장의표시:후추의 갯수가 부족합니다.
아니오의경우>
문장의표시:알겠습니다.
----------------------------------------------------------------------------------
이경우에는 시세가 클릭할때마다 달라진다고 해서 변경 합니다.

조건분기:[9:항해일수]1 이상
변수의조작:[10:시세 가산or감산]대입,난수1~2
조건분기:[10:시세 가산or감산]1과 같은값
변수의조작:[1:향신료시세]가산,난수0~3
조건분기:[1:향신료시세]가 120초과
변수의조작:[1:향신료시세]대입,120
그외의경우
분기종료
그외의경우
변수의조작:[1:향신료시세]감산,난수0~3
조건분기:[1:향신료시세]가 80미만
변수의조작:[1:향신료시세]대입,80
그외의경우
분기종료
그외의경우
분기종료

변수의조작:[2:후추가격]대입,300 (300원의경우)
변수의조작:[2:후추가격]곱셈,[변수1]
변수의조작:[2:후추가격]나눗셈,100
문장의표시: 현제 후추의 시세는 V[1]이여서,
                 현제 후추가격은 V[2]입니다. 사시겠습니까?
선택지의표시:예,아니오
예의경우>
문장의표시:몇개를사시겠습니까?
수치입력의처리:3자리 [3:후추팔고사는갯수]에유효
문장의표시:정말로 V[3]만큼 사시겠습니까?
선택지의표시:예,아니오
예의경우>
변수의조작[2:후추가격]곱셈,[변수3]
문장의표시:후추의 총가격은 V[2]입니다. 사시겠습니까?
선택지의표시:예,아니오
예의경우>
변수의조작:[4:현제 주인공이 가진돈]대입,가진돈
조건분기:[2]가 [4]이하
가진돈의증감:변수[2]만큼 감산
변수의조작:[5:후추갯수]가산,[변수3]
변수의조작:[6:적재량]가산,[변수3]
그외의경우:
문장의표시:돈이 부족합니다.
아니오의경우>
문장의표시:알겠습니다
아니오의경우>
문장의표시:알겠습니다.
아니오의경우>
문장의표시:알겠습니다.

자 이런식으로 하면 항해일수가 1일이 지날때마다 1~3%씩 감소or증가합니다.(단 처음 시작할때 시세를 정해줘야하는 번거로움이...) 또한 시세가 80~120사이에서 왔다 갔다 하죠.

그리고 구입시 **개 이상구입 or판매시 **개 이상판매시 대폭락,대폭등 스위치를 만들어 on시키고 시세에 특정량을 대입, 그리고 위의 시스템을 복사하여 붙여넣기하고 40~60사이로 시세를 잡아도 돼죠.

그리고 또한, 각 마을마다 시세를 정해줄려면 약간 힘들꺼라 하셨는데,실제로는 진짜 마을마다 달라야합니다.

하지만 서지중해,북해,동지중해,아프리카,인도 이런식으로 나누어준다면 약간만 만들어도 됩니다.

또한, **마을에서 판매하고있는 물품은 물가가 싼데, 그런경우는 가격쪽에서 손봐주면됩니다.

그럼 이만~~ 또 수정할것이있으면 수정으로하겠습니다+_+
?

List of Articles
번호 분류 제목 글쓴이 날짜 조회 수
1004 언어/기타 흥크립트 팁 A. 미스릴 2007.12.30 1585
1003 언어/기타 흠..스토리 짜는 법? Mr.kim 2006.02.12 842
1002 RPG Maker 흠.. 그림의 표시로 던파를 만들어볼까? 예화 2005.10.01 930
1001 언어/기타 흠. 돈을 무제한으로만드는건... 상한굴비 2005.10.05 766
1000 언어/기타 흔한 스토리.. 지겹지 않니? MiNi'M' 2006.01.06 755
999 언어/기타 흐흐응. 끄덕일만한 아이디어. 다크세이버™ 2006.07.09 869
998 언어/기타 후훗.. 피군 2006.08.08 658
997 RPG Maker 후냐.. RPG M2K로 제작한 뽑기입니다.^^ The_cat 2005.10.16 761
996 언어/기타 획기적인 게임 제작 제1편(게임의 전체적인 분위기의 선택) Santiago 2006.12.04 1389
995 언어/기타 확인 dnajs 2006.09.24 423
994 언어/기타 화성학 기초 2 file C코드선생 2009.07.21 1020
993 언어/기타 화면 좌표의 이해와 활용 file CC(虎) 2005.08.18 818
992 언어/기타 호러게임을 만들고 싶다면..? 필기도구 2005.12.10 728
991 언어/기타 허접들의 nwc 다루기 - 멜로디 쓰기 file 예쓰™ 2005.07.12 1298
990 언어/기타 허기와 피로도 『연금술사』 2005.12.27 544
989 언어/기타 항해시대에 들어가는 시스템.(몇가지) Ress 2006.01.06 752
988 언어/기타 항해시대 게임에서의 아이디어 ! 다크세이버™ 2006.01.04 446
987 언어/기타 함정 file 『레드』 2006.07.29 663
986 RPG Maker 한방씩 주고 받는 턴제식 rpg 잠시 30분동안 만들어봣습니다 .ㅋ *YeNa* 2005.12.30 388
985 언어/기타 한국 위키백과를 추천합니다. MrGeek 2006.08.29 408
Board Pagination Prev 1 2 3 4 5 6 7 8 9 10 ... 51 Next
/ 51






[개인정보취급방침] | [이용약관] | [제휴문의] | [후원창구] | [인디사이드연혁]

Copyright © 1999 - 2016 INdiSide.com/(주)씨엘쓰리디 All Rights Reserved.
인디사이드 운영자 : 천무(이지선) | kernys(김원배) | 사신지(김병국)